Chapter 6. Cluster Administrator Setup


Authentication

Set up the authentication using AllowAll Authentication method.

AllowAll Authentication
Set up an authentication model which allows all passwords. Edit /etc/origin/master/master-config.yaml on the OpenShift master and change the value of DenyAllPasswordIdentityProvider to AllowAllPasswordIdentityProvider. Then restart the OpenShift master.
  1. Now that the authentication model has been setup, login as a user, for example admin/admin:
    # oc login openshift master e.g. https://1.1.1.1:8443  --username=admin --password=admin

  2. Grant the admin user account the cluster-admin role.
      # oc login -u system:admin -n default
      Logged into "https:// <<openshift_master_fqdn>>:8443" as "system:admin" using existing credentials.
    
      You have access to the following projects and can switch between them with 'oc project <projectname>':
    
      *default
       glusterfs
       infra-storage
       kube-public
       kube-system
       management-infra
       openshift
       openshift-infra
       openshift-logging
       openshift-node
       openshift-sdn
       openshift-web-console
    
      Using project "default".
    
      # oc adm policy add-cluster-role-to-user cluster-admin admin
      cluster role "cluster-admin" added: "admin"
